Operational CRM automates daily tasks in sales, marketing, and support. It helps organize contacts, manage leads, and improve customer service speed. This type suits businesses that want to handle customer interactions efficiently and effectively.
Analytical CRM collects and studies customer data to find trends and behaviors. It provides valuable insights that help companies plan more effective marketing and sales strategies. This type is suitable for those who want to make decisions based on facts and numbers.
Collaborative CRM enables teams, such as sales, support, and marketing, to share customer information. This keeps everyone updated and helps customers get consistent service. It works well when different teams need to work closely.
Strategic CRM focuses on building strong, long-term relationships with customers. It links CRM work directly to company goals, helping to keep customers loyal. This type suits businesses that want to keep customers coming back.
Business Size | Best CRM Type(s) | Why It Fits |
Small | Operational CRM | Simple tasks, quick setup, manage daily contacts |
Mid-sized | Operational + Analytical | Need task automation plus data insights |
Large | Collaborative + Analytical | Multiple teams sharing data, deeper analysis |
Team Setup | Best CRM Type(s) | Reason |
Small team with simple tasks | Operational CRM | Easy to use, quick automation |
Teams needing to share customer info | Collaborative CRM | Avoids silos, improves customer experience |
Data analysis focused teams | Analytical CRM | Provides detailed reports and customer insights |
